Welcome To The Urban Revolution
Jeb Brugmann

How Cities Are Changing the World

Bloomsbury USA
May 2010
On Sale: April 27, 2010
368 pages
ISBN: 1608190927
EAN: 9781608190928
Hardcover
Add to Wish List

Non-Fiction

As of this decade, more than half the earth’s population lives in cities; our world is not just globalized, but urbanized. This powerful reappraisal draws on two decades of fieldwork and research to show how the metropolis has become a medium for revolutionary social change. Not just political upheaval but technological, economic, and cultural innovations are forged in our urban centers. From Chicago to Mumbai, in every corner of the world, the city is now a laboratory for revolution, brewing potential solutions to poverty, inequality, and sustainability. Bridging urban studies, economics, and sociology, Jeb Brugmann’s Welcome to the Urban Revolution turns traditional urbanism on its head, and offers an inspiring new way of understanding our cities.
